Subject: Welcome to the Spoolhaven on-call rotation

Hey, welcome aboard! You're now on the pager for Spoolhaven, our printer-spooler microservice. It's mostly quiet, but when it acts up it's usually one of two things: a stuck queue in the Dunmere region or a stale driver cache after a deploy. Restarting the worker pool fixes 90% of pages. Don't panic, escalate to the Inkwright team if anything looks weird with the renderer. Everything you need — runbooks, dashboards, escalation steps — is here:

operations page: https://confluence.qorvelsys.internal/browse/projects/projects/f004fd0d

### TICKET-4821: Rate limiting rollout on Gatewick internal gateway — sign-off required

We're enabling token-bucket rate limiting on Gatewick for all internal service routes, starting at 500 req/s per caller with burst of 100. Shadow mode ran clean for two weeks; no legitimate traffic would have been throttled. On-call: watch for 429 spikes in the first 48 hours and roll back via the "limits-off" flag if needed. Deployment is blocked pending sign-off from the engineer named below.

approver of kawig-fahof = Wenvan Prair

Handover: Orphan Sweeper (Gravelight)

Tomas — taking over the Gravelight orphaned-resource sweeper from Ilka. It scans nightly for unattached volumes and stale snapshots, tags them, deletes after 14 days. Security-relevant: deletion scope is gated by a sealed config. If the seal is tripped during review, reopen it with the recovery passphrase below.

strongbox words: wenix-ulador